Image Source from tiffanyhogrefeHow to Set Up Your HoneyBook (For Photographers): A Guide to Streamlining Your Passive Income Streams
As a photographer seeking to maximise your productivity and create passive income streams, setting up HoneyBook can be a game changer. HoneyBook is an all-in-one business management software designed to help creative entrepreneurs streamline their workflow, from managing clients to handling payments. In this article, we'll explore how to set up your HoneyBook account specifically for photography businesses, ensuring you can manage your operations efficiently while focusing on generating income.
What is HoneyBook and Why Should Photographers Use It?
Understanding HoneyBook
HoneyBook is a comprehensive platform that allows photographers to manage various aspects of their business, including client communication, project management, invoices, and contracts. This tool is particularly beneficial for photographers who want to automate administrative tasks, enabling them to devote more time to their craft.
Benefits for Photographers
- Streamlined Workflow: Automate scheduling, invoicing, and contracts to save time.
- Professional Image: Create customised proposals and contracts that present a polished brand image.
- Income Tracking: Monitor payments easily to keep track of your passive income streams.
- Client Management: Maintain and nurture client relationships through effective communication tools.
Setting Up Your HoneyBook Account
Step 1: Create Your HoneyBook Account
To get started, visit the HoneyBook website and sign up for an account. HoneyBook offers a free trial, allowing you to explore its features without any financial commitment. You will need to provide your email address and create a secure password.
Step 2: Personalise Your Profile
After signing up, the first thing you should do is personalise your profile:
- Upload a Professional Headshot: Use a high-quality image that reflects your brand.
- Add Your Business Name: Make sure it is consistent with your branding across all platforms.
- Fill in Your Contact Information: Include your phone number, email, and website to make it easy for clients to reach you.
Step 3: Customise Your Brand Settings
HoneyBook allows you to customise your brand aesthetics:
- Brand Colour Palette: Choose colours that represent your brand to incorporate into your proposals and communications.
- Logo Upload: Upload your logo for a cohesive professional look across all documentation.
Step 4: Set Up Your Services
To adequately define your offerings, you must outline your photography services:
- List Your Photography Packages: Specify detailed descriptions for each service, including pricing and deliverables.
- Create a Portfolio: Showcase your best work associated with each package, maximising the chances of converting inquiries into bookings.
Step 5: Create Templates for Proposals and Contracts
Having templates readily available saves you time when working with clients:
- Proposal Template: Build a customised template that includes your services, pricing, terms, and examples of your work. Make sure to include a call-to-action.
- Contract Template: Ensure you have a solid contract in place that outlines the terms of service, payment details, and cancellation policies.
Step 6: Integrate Your Calendar
Synchronising your HoneyBook with your calendar (Google Calendar, Apple Calendar, etc.) is crucial for managing bookings efficiently. This integration ensures you never double-book clients and can see your availability at a glance.
Automating Communication for Passive Income
Step 7: Set Up Client Workflows
Create automated workflows to improve client interactions:
- Inquiry Response: Draft a template for responding to client inquiries promptly.
- Booking Confirmation: Automatically send a booking confirmation email that outlines the next steps for the client.
- Follow-Up Emails: Schedule emails to follow up with clients post-session and encourage them to refer you to others.
Step 8: Invoice Automation
HoneyBook allows you to set up automated invoicing, a key feature for managing passive income streams:
- Create Invoice Templates: Develop invoices that reflect your brand and make them easy to understand.
- Set Payment Reminders: Automate reminders for upcoming payments to ensure consistent cash flow.
Expanding Your Passive Income Streams
The Importance of Upselling and Cross-Selling
One way to enhance your income is by upselling and cross-selling. Use HoneyBook to:
- Offer Additional Services: At the end of a package, suggest related services such as prints, albums, or future sessions.
- Discounts for Referrals: Create an incentive system that rewards clients who refer new customers.
Collecting Reviews and Testimonials
Leveraging positive feedback can significantly improve your credibility and attract new clients:
- Request Reviews: After completing a project, use HoneyBook to send an automatic email requesting feedback.
- Display Testimonials: Feature these on your website or social media to enhance your brand’s reputation.
